The O'Jays File A $1 Million Lawsuit Against Crown Royal For Their Commercial Featuring Big K.R.I.T.

Soul music stars The O’Jays have filed a lawsuit against Crown Royal over the use of their hit song ‘For the Love of Money’. They say they were humiliated by the advertisement which features Big K.R.I.T. rapping over the song. They called K.R.I.T. “a poser with limited ability to carry a tune” who performed a “self-aggrandizing childish rap.” They are seeking more than a million dollars in damages.
